Adu-Addo Leads Lancers to Set Top Marks as Pre-Postseason Invitational

Worcester, MA- The Worcester State Women's Indoor Track and Field competed in the final regular season meet at the Pre-Postseason Invitational hosted by Wheaton College. The meet is set as one of the final chances for individuals to hit qualifying marks for regional championships and the NCAA tournament.

 

Worcester State was up to the challenge at Wheaton, hitting top marks in numerous events on the day. First year Ciara Adu-Addo (Worcester, MA) would claim sixth in the 60m with a time of 8.24. She would claim her highest spot of the day though in the long jump, with a first place finish on a mark of 5.21m. Junior Eryca Lopes would claim ninth in the event with 4.41m measurement while also claiming ninth in the triple jump with a landing at 9.56m.

 

The Lancers had a dual 6th place finish on the track with junior Carly Gilson (Grafton, MA) claiming the spot in the 400m with a 64.15 seconds while first year Lexie Zakrzewski (Taunton, MA) would grab the position in the 600m with a time of 1:56.69. Sophomore Bridget O'Malley (Leominster, MA) would finish in 11th in the 800m as fellow sophomore Leah Berg (Worcester, MA) would close out the Lancers time in the track with a 7th place time of 11:42.82 in the 3,000m

 

On the throwing pit side, the success would continue for Worcester State as first year Jadah Stokes (Savannah, GA) would grab two second place finishes in both the weight throw and shot put. A distance of 11.95m would do the trick in the shot put while 13.63m would be all that is needed in the weight throw. Joining Stokes in both event was senior Sthanisha Moreau (Taunton, MA) who would grab fifth in the shot out with a marking of 10.02m and a ninth place mark of 10.16m in the weight throw. 

 

The Blue and Gold return to action next Sunday at the New England D3 Regional NCAA tournament as they strive for final marks for NCAA championship qualification.
